Frequently asked questions

Which officers must a PLC have?

A minimum of two directors and a company secretary holding prescribed qualifications (e.g. chartered secretary, solicitor, accountant) — stricter than the Ltd regime.

What appointment data is public?

Names, roles, appointment and resignation dates, nationality, occupation and service addresses, for current and past officers.

Why track PLC board changes?

Board reshuffles at public companies precede strategy shifts and distress; the dated register history is the neutral record of who served when.
